Risk Advisory
During the adjustment period, the affected trading pairs will be temporarily suspended for 2 minutes. Users will be unable to place orders, cancel orders, add margin, or transfer funds for these pairs. Other trading pairs will remain unaffected. To minimize trading disruption, users are advised to cancel orders, reduce positions, or add margin in advance.
Rules for Order and Position Handling During Adjustments
A. Trading Currency Quantity Precision Adjustments
1. Order Handling Rules
For reductions in precision (e.g., 0.0001 → 0.01):
- Limit orders with quantity precision exceeding the new standard will be canceled.
- Strategy orders (e.g., grid, martingale) will be terminated if canceled. Other strategies (e.g., TWAP, iceberg) will resume trading with the new precision.
For increases in precision (e.g., 0.01 → 0.0001):
- All active orders will remain unchanged.
2. Position and Order Display Rules
- After precision reduction, order quantities will display at the new precision level for web/mobile users. API users retain original precision.
- Precision increases retain original display rules.
B. Minimum Price Precision Adjustments
1. Order Handling Rules
For reductions in precision (e.g., 0.0001 → 0.01):
- Orders with price precision exceeding the new standard will be canceled.
- Strategy orders follow the same rules as quantity adjustments.
For increases in precision (e.g., 0.01 → 0.0001):
- No order cancellations occur.
2. Position and Order Display Rules
- Post-adjustment, prices display at new precision ("buy orders rounded down, sell orders rounded up") for web/mobile users. API users retain original precision.
